I really enjoy taking photos outdoors. Using the environment to create a unique element in an image makes me smile a little on the inside. Yes, I admit it. It keeps my job fun and almost always guarantees that the experience will never quite be the same. In the beautiful state of Michigan this is true even while using the exact same location on multiple occasions. That might be difficult for you to believe but its really TRUE. With seasonal changes occurring so frequently (every few months) the scenery flaunts tempting new elements every few weeks or so.
Recently I have been working with some terrific models on outdoor photoshoots. These outings have been more artsy in theme and involved full creative teams including wardrobe styling, make-up artists, hairstyling and sometimes photo assisting. Although the below images appear to have been captured during the peak of Autumn’s colorful foilage change they were truthfully taken quite a bit later….in early to mid November and were processed in post to give off a painterly or slightly vintage vibe.
